Q:   Is Robotics a high paying career?
A: 

Yes, a career in Robotics pays well in India. In India, robotics engineers make an average yearly pay of INR 6 LPA. The level of expertise, the sector and the location, however, can all affect the income. The salary for following domains are given as belows (for candidates having minimum 2-3 years of experience)

  • Defence Sector: 8-9 LPA
  • Manufacturing: 7- 8 LPA
  • Automotive: 8- 9 LPA

Professionals can anticipate a nice salary if Robotics is their field of choice in India. Robotics engineers are in high demand as the industry expands quickly. In India, Robotics is a field where one can succeed if one has the necessary training and expertise.

Q:   Can a robotics engineer work in NASA?
A: 

Hi, yes Robotics Engineers can work at both NASA and ISRO. Robotics Engineers design, build, test and maintain and develop specialised robots for planetary rovers, robotic arms and autonomous drones. They play a significant role in space exploration, satellite maintenance and research, etc.

Q:   What is the Robotics Engineering course duration?
A: 

The Robotics Engineering duration in India varies based on the course level of the course. For UG Robotics Engg. courses, the duration is usually 4 years in India. For PG courses, you will have to invest 2 years. Also, for Diploma courses in Robotics Engineering, the duration is 3 years after completing Class 10.
You can also go for a PhD in Robotics Engg. course, which is usually 3 to 5 years long.
